
Ernesto Resende developed and enhanced multiple API clients and SDK features within the epilot-dev/sdk-js repository over seven months, focusing on robust data modeling and integration. He introduced entity-based context modeling for notes, advanced search endpoints, and automation actions that improved workflow orchestration and data discoverability. Ernesto applied TypeScript and Node.js to design type-safe interfaces, OpenAPI-driven schemas, and maintainable client libraries, ensuring clear data contracts and scalable role-based access control. His work addressed evolving business needs by enabling richer context-driven operations, safer integrations, and extensible automation, demonstrating a thoughtful approach to API client development and backend integration with strong technical depth.

September 2025 (2025-09) highlights a targeted OpenAPI and SDK enhancement in the epilot-dev/sdk-js repository. Delivered schema and client improvements to better represent assignable entities and support email-based workflows, aligning client data with server expectations and enabling more reliable partner-directory operations. Implemented via a focused commit to fix and extend the schema, laying groundwork for downstream automation and higher-quality integrations.
September 2025 (2025-09) highlights a targeted OpenAPI and SDK enhancement in the epilot-dev/sdk-js repository. Delivered schema and client improvements to better represent assignable entities and support email-based workflows, aligning client data with server expectations and enabling more reliable partner-directory operations. Implemented via a focused commit to fix and extend the schema, laying groundwork for downstream automation and higher-quality integrations.
2025-08 Monthly Summary for epilot-dev/sdk-js: Key feature delivery in permissions client, groundwork for scalable RBAC; no major bugs fixed this month; business impact through safer, scalable access control and faster integrations.
2025-08 Monthly Summary for epilot-dev/sdk-js: Key feature delivery in permissions client, groundwork for scalable RBAC; no major bugs fixed this month; business impact through safer, scalable access control and faster integrations.
July 2025 monthly summary focusing on key accomplishments and business impact. The main delivery this month is a major upgrade to the Notes API client within the epilot-dev/sdk-js repository, enabling richer context modeling and advanced search capabilities that unlock more precise, context-driven note retrieval and workflow support.
July 2025 monthly summary focusing on key accomplishments and business impact. The main delivery this month is a major upgrade to the Notes API client within the epilot-dev/sdk-js repository, enabling richer context modeling and advanced search capabilities that unlock more precise, context-driven note retrieval and workflow support.
June 2025 — epilot-dev/sdk-js: Delivered the Epilot Address Suggestions API Client Library for Node.js. Key components include configuration, type definitions, and a basic client using openapi-client-axios to fetch address suggestions and validate availability files. This foundation enables faster, reliable integration for downstream apps and sets the stage for future enhancements. No major bugs fixed this period.
June 2025 — epilot-dev/sdk-js: Delivered the Epilot Address Suggestions API Client Library for Node.js. Key components include configuration, type definitions, and a basic client using openapi-client-axios to fetch address suggestions and validate availability files. This foundation enables faster, reliable integration for downstream apps and sets the stage for future enhancements. No major bugs fixed this period.
May 2025 monthly summary for epilot-dev/sdk-js. Delivered a new automation capability by introducing TriggerShareEntityAction, enabling sharing of entities across automation workflows. The change includes new interfaces for the action, its configuration, and shared configuration, and updates to AnyAction to support the new action, expanding automation capabilities and workflow orchestration. This work improves cross-workflow collaboration, reduces duplication, and broadens the platform’s automation scenarios. Maintenance included aligning the automation client with latest changes via a version bump.
May 2025 monthly summary for epilot-dev/sdk-js. Delivered a new automation capability by introducing TriggerShareEntityAction, enabling sharing of entities across automation workflows. The change includes new interfaces for the action, its configuration, and shared configuration, and updates to AnyAction to support the new action, expanding automation capabilities and workflow orchestration. This work improves cross-workflow collaboration, reduces duplication, and broadens the platform’s automation scenarios. Maintenance included aligning the automation client with latest changes via a version bump.
February 2025: Focused API surface improvement in epilot-dev/sdk-js. Delivered new NoteContexts interface and updated GetNotesByContext response to provide clearer data contracts; released corresponding notes-client version bump. This work lays groundwork for richer note context features and safer downstream integration.
February 2025: Focused API surface improvement in epilot-dev/sdk-js. Delivered new NoteContexts interface and updated GetNotesByContext response to provide clearer data contracts; released corresponding notes-client version bump. This work lays groundwork for richer note context features and safer downstream integration.
2025-01 performance summary for epilot-dev/sdk-js. Key deliverable: Notes Client Contextual Data Enhancements enabling entity-based contexts in the notes client, including a new 'entity' context type, a dedicated endpoint to retrieve note contexts, and a WorkflowExecution schema. This work improves association of notes with specific entities and data workflows, enhancing search, organization, and contextual relationships. Commits illustrate the implementation and versioning: 411512988d6a57299b281ca2d2443155ad314d4a and eeb625a6de3052c6b89fee0428de13bbc36e690b. No major bug fixes were documented in this period. Impact: improved data discoverability, governance, and workflow visibility across the SDK; easier integration for downstream apps. Technologies/skills: API design, client SDK evolution, data modeling (entity contexts, WorkflowExecution), versioning, and conventional commits.
2025-01 performance summary for epilot-dev/sdk-js. Key deliverable: Notes Client Contextual Data Enhancements enabling entity-based contexts in the notes client, including a new 'entity' context type, a dedicated endpoint to retrieve note contexts, and a WorkflowExecution schema. This work improves association of notes with specific entities and data workflows, enhancing search, organization, and contextual relationships. Commits illustrate the implementation and versioning: 411512988d6a57299b281ca2d2443155ad314d4a and eeb625a6de3052c6b89fee0428de13bbc36e690b. No major bug fixes were documented in this period. Impact: improved data discoverability, governance, and workflow visibility across the SDK; easier integration for downstream apps. Technologies/skills: API design, client SDK evolution, data modeling (entity contexts, WorkflowExecution), versioning, and conventional commits.
Overview of all repositories you've contributed to across your timeline